Our Air Quality & Ventilation Services in Sausalito
Our Air Quality & Ventilation team designs each system around Sausalito’s specific climate pressures: persistent moisture, salt corrosion, and tightly constructed hillside homes with limited mechanical space.
Air Filtration
Homes near the water in Sausalito pull in more than standard pollen loads. The marine layer carries fine salt particulates that standard fiberglass filters miss entirely, coating indoor surfaces and stressing HVAC components. We size MERV-rated filtration to your actual air handler capacity, not some generic chart. For the tighter homes above Bridgeway with limited return air pathways, we often recommend media filters with lower static pressure drop to avoid straining aging blower motors.

Humidifier Installation
Here’s the paradox Sausalito homeowners learn fast: you’re surrounded by water, yet indoor winter humidity can drop below 30% when heaters run continuously through fog-season cold snaps. Heating & Furnace — Sausalito systems paired with whole-home humidifiers solve this without the mold risk of portable units. We install bypass and fan-powered models from Lennox and Aprilaire, sized to your square footage and duct configuration. In floating homes where ductwork is minimal or absent, we specify direct-discharge steam units that don’t depend on forced-air distribution.

Dehumidifier Installation
Summer afternoons in Sausalito rarely break 70°F, but humidity can linger at 80% plus when the marine layer stalls. That dampness breeds musty odors in crawl spaces and encourages dust mites even without true heat. We install whole-house dehumidifiers tied to your central system, plus dedicated basement and crawl-space units for hillside homes with foundation moisture issues. For the liveaboard community, marine-rated dehumidification is essentially mandatory; standard residential units corrode within two seasons on the water.

UV Air Purifier Installation
UV-C lamps mounted in your air handler or ductwork neutralize mold spores, bacteria, and viruses on the pass. In Sausalito’s moisture-rich environment, evaporator coils stay wet longer than inland systems, creating ideal biological growth conditions. We install UV systems from Goodman and Rheem product lines that mount directly at the coil and second-stage lamps in return ducting. Common Air Quality & Ventilation Problems We See in Sausalito Homes
- Salt corrosion destroying outdoor air quality components. The marine layer bathing Sausalito in moisture carries enough salt to pit aluminum fins and corrode copper within three to five years. Standard equipment rated for inland use fails prematurely here; we specify coated coils and stainless hardware for any outdoor-mounted component.
- Hillside homes with zero original ductwork. Those charming 1920s–1960s cottages above Caledonia Street and Bridgeway were built for gravity heat or wall furnaces. Adding central air quality equipment means either creative mini-split zoning or extensive duct retrofit through inaccessible crawl spaces. We’ve navigated both approaches dozens of times.
- Floating-home ventilation that fights the envelope. Liveaboards on Gate 5 Road exchange air constantly with the marina environment. Standard bath fans and range hoods create negative pressure that pulls diesel exhaust and bilge odors inward. We design balanced ventilation with dedicated makeup air for these unique structures.
- Condensation on windows and structural cold spots. When warm, moist interior air hits single-pane original glass or uninsulated framing in older Sausalito homes, water pools and mold follows. Proper ventilation design, not just equipment sizing, prevents this. We calculate air changes per room, not just whole-house averages.
Pricing for Air Quality & Ventilation in Sausalito, CA
We’re straightforward about numbers because vague pricing wastes everyone’s time. In Sausalito’s market, a typical whole-home air filtration upgrade runs $340–$780 installed, depending on whether we’re retrofitting media filtration into existing returns or adding a dedicated bypass HEPA system. Humidifier installations range from $520–$1,180 for bypass models to $1,340–$2,200 for steam units in homes without ductwork. Dehumidifier systems start around $1,180–$2,450 for whole-house units, with marine-rated floating-home configurations at the higher end. UV air purifier installations typically fall between $380–$720 per lamp location, including electrical and mounting.
What moves you within these ranges? Existing electrical access, duct configuration, equipment accessibility, and whether we’re matching to a legacy system or designing fresh.
